Subject: Pagination changes shipping in Harborline API v2.4

Hey folks,

Quick heads-up for anyone new to the Harborline public REST API: starting with v2.4 we're moving from offset-based pagination to cursor tokens. Offset params still work but are deprecated and will log warnings. Cursors are opaque — don't parse them, don't store them longer than an hour. The docs team at Quillbrook has updated the examples, so point customers there.

Rollout hits staging Thursday, prod next Monday. The build token for this release is below.

pipeline stamp: htk9_ce63042d9

## Changelog — Font vendoring defaults changed

As of this release, the Bracken UI build no longer fetches third-party fonts at build time. All typefaces used by the Lanternwell suite are now vendored into the repo under a dedicated assets directory, and the fetch step is skipped by default. If you're onboarding, nothing to install — the fonts travel with the checkout. The build flags controlling this behavior are listed below.

settings of hadup-yafog:
LAMAEL_PIN=3761
LAMAEL_TENANT=istmir
LAMAEL_METRICS_HOST=metrics.lamael.plorvasys.test
LAMAEL_SEAL=seal_8ea68500
LAMAEL_STANDBY_TEAM=fraok

Internal Memo — Transport of Gallery Labels

To: Office Manager

The printed labels for the new Larkspell Gallery are complete and packed in three sealed cartons at the front office. Orveth Couriers will collect them tomorrow between 9 and 11. Counts have been verified against the curatorial list and recorded in the shipping log. Please ensure the cartons remain sealed and unmoved until collection. The courier exchange must be carried out according to the following instruction.

courier memo of fajeg-yagag: the pramir keleth courier leaves the wenax holox ralix ledger at gate 8171 under passcode 428648

**Break-glass: Verrow query planner regression**

Scope: Release 4.2 shipped a planner change in Haldane DB that degrades join ordering on wide tables. Rollback flag exists but is gated behind the emergency config store. Use break-glass only if p99 latency exceeds 2s sustained for 10 minutes. Steps: page on-call, confirm regression via the Stennick dashboard, then unseal the config store and flip `planner_legacy=true`. Log the action in the release channel immediately. Unsealing requires the recovery passphrase, which follows below.

strongbox words: praath-queniel-holax-druael-jorath-noveth-druok